  • Title

    Power allocation for nonregenerative OFDM relay links with outdated channel knowledge

  • Abstract
    This paper investigates the power allocation problem in a two-hop OFDM relay link with a nonregenarative relay where the available channel state information (CSI) is an outdated version of the actual instantaneous CSI. A power allocation method is proposed to maximize the expected capacity, assuming that the correlation between the outdated and instantaneous CSI is known. The performance is compared with that of the baseline method, where the power allocation is performed solely based on the outdated CSI. Results confirm that the proposed method outperforms the baseline method when the available CSI is highly outdated.
